1

我已经使用 Spring Native 构建了一个 docker 映像。容器内的 Spring Boot 应用程序侦听端口 80,但由于缺少访问权限(似乎 docker 不允许使用低于 1024 的端口),因此在启动时在 Azure Functions 上崩溃。如何更改 Azure Functions 用于访问 docker 映像中的应用程序的端口?

4

1 回答 1

2

如果您使用的是 80 或 8080,Azure 将自动检测使用的端口

可以使用环境变量“Function App -> Settings -> Configuration -> New application settings”将每个其他WEBSITES_PORT端口配置为 8081(或应用程序侦听的那个)。

于 2021-11-10T16:38:48.337 回答